1. Out参数
#region 1.Out参数 var str = "2"; ///之前的写法 { int iValue; //将str转化成int类型,若转化成功,将值赋给iValue,并返回true;若转化失败,返回false。 if (int.TryParse(str, out iValue)) { WriteLine(iValue); } } //C#7的写法 { if (int.TryParse(str, out int iValue)) { WriteLine(iValue); } //或者 if (int.TryParse(str, out var vValue)) { WriteLine(iValue); } }
没有评论:
发表评论